10 Surprising Facts About Communism

Communism is an economic system where everyone shares in the collective wealth.

Under communism, the means of production are owned and controlled by the community.

Marx and Engels were the founding fathers of communism.

The Soviet Union was the largest communist country in the world.

Communism aims to create a classless society.

The Communist Manifesto was a defining work in the development of communism.

Countries like China and Cuba still have communist governments.

Communism seeks to eliminate social inequalities.

In communism, there is no private ownership of property.

Communism advocates for the equal distribution of wealth.

Karl Marx believed that capitalism would inevitably lead to communism.

Communism has been a source of controversy and political turmoil throughout history.

Socialist countries often have elements of communism in their economic systems.

Communism emphasizes cooperation and community over individualistic pursuits.

Communism prioritizes the needs of the many over the needs of the few.

In a communist society, resources are allocated by central planning rather than market forces.

Comrade is a term commonly used in communist circles to refer to fellow revolutionaries.

The labor theory of value is a key concept in communist economics.

Many countries transitioned from capitalism to communism through violent revolutions.

Communism has had both positive and negative impacts on society throughout its history.
